Common allergens in scented candles

Scented candles, while popular for their aromatic appeal, can harbor allergens that trigger adverse reactions in sensitive individuals. The primary culprits are often hidden in the fragrance oils, wax bases, and additives used in their production. For instance, synthetic fragrances, which make up the majority of scented candles, frequently contain phthalates—chemicals linked to hormonal disruptions and respiratory issues. Even candles labeled "natural" may include essential oils like lavender or eucalyptus, known to cause skin irritation or allergic contact dermatitis in some people. Understanding these components is the first step in identifying potential allergens.

Analyzing the wax composition reveals another layer of concern. Paraffin wax, derived from petroleum, releases volatile organic compounds (VOCs) when burned, which can irritate the lungs and exacerbate asthma symptoms. Soy and beeswax candles are often marketed as safer alternatives, but they aren’t allergen-free. Soy wax, for example, may be contaminated with pesticide residues if not sourced organically, while beeswax can trigger reactions in individuals with bee-related allergies. Even the wicks, often coated with metal or treated with chemicals, can release irritants when burned, further complicating the allergen profile.

Practical steps can mitigate exposure to these allergens. Opt for candles made from 100% organic soy or beeswax, ensuring they are free from synthetic additives. Look for fragrance-free options or those scented with pure essential oils in minimal quantities. For those with respiratory sensitivities, limiting burn time to 1–2 hours per session and ensuring proper ventilation can reduce VOC inhalation. Patch testing new candles on a small area of skin before extended use can also help identify potential irritants early.

Comparatively, unscented candles made from natural waxes are the safest bet for allergy-prone individuals. However, even these can pose risks if the wax is processed with harmful chemicals. Reading labels carefully and choosing products certified by reputable organizations, such as the Asthma and Allergy Foundation of America, can provide added assurance. While scented candles create ambiance, prioritizing health by selecting allergen-conscious options ensures enjoyment without compromise.

Symptoms of candle allergies

Scented candles, while cozy and inviting, can trigger allergic reactions in sensitive individuals. The symptoms often mimic those of seasonal allergies or irritant reactions, making them easy to overlook. Common signs include sneezing, a runny or stuffy nose, and itchy or watery eyes. These occur as the immune system responds to allergens released by the burning candle, such as fragrance chemicals or particulate matter. If you notice these symptoms worsening when candles are lit, consider this a red flag.

Beyond respiratory issues, skin reactions are another telltale sign of candle allergies. Prolonged exposure to scented candles can cause contact dermatitis, characterized by redness, itching, or a rash, particularly in areas close to the candle. This happens when the skin absorbs volatile organic compounds (VOCs) or synthetic fragrances. To test for this, observe if symptoms appear after handling candles or being in close proximity to them for extended periods.

Headaches and migraines are often overlooked symptoms of candle allergies. Certain fragrances, especially synthetic ones, can act as neurotoxins, triggering headaches in susceptible individuals. If you experience unexplained headaches when candles are burning, try eliminating them from your environment for a week. Note any changes in symptom frequency or intensity to determine if candles are the culprit.

For those with asthma, scented candles can be particularly problematic. The inhalation of fragrance particles can irritate the airways, leading to coughing, wheezing, or shortness of breath. Asthmatics should monitor their peak flow readings when candles are in use. If readings drop significantly, it’s a strong indicator that candles are exacerbating asthma symptoms. In such cases, opting for fragrance-free alternatives is advisable.

Finally, systemic reactions like fatigue or dizziness may occur in severe cases. These symptoms arise from the body’s overall response to allergens, particularly in individuals with multiple chemical sensitivities (MCS). If you experience persistent fatigue or dizziness in the presence of scented candles, consult an allergist. They can perform tests to identify specific triggers and recommend appropriate management strategies.

How to test for candle allergies

Scented candles, while cozy and inviting, can trigger allergic reactions in some individuals. If you suspect you’re sensitive to them, testing for allergies systematically is crucial. Start by isolating the candle as the potential allergen. Burn a scented candle in a well-ventilated room for 15–20 minutes, then leave the area for an hour. Upon returning, observe for immediate symptoms like sneezing, itching, or nasal congestion. This simple exposure test can provide initial clues but isn’t definitive—it’s a starting point to narrow down your suspicions.

For a more controlled approach, consider a patch test, typically used for skin allergies but adaptable here. Light a candle in a closed container with a small opening, allowing minimal fragrance to escape. Hold your hand near the opening for 5–10 minutes, then observe for skin reactions like redness, itching, or hives. While this method focuses on dermal responses, it can indicate sensitivity to the chemicals in the candle’s fragrance or wax. Note that this isn’t a medical test but a practical way to gauge immediate skin reactions.

If you’re serious about identifying a candle allergy, consult an allergist for a professional evaluation. They may perform a skin prick test, introducing small amounts of common candle components (e.g., synthetic fragrances, essential oils, or paraffin wax) into the skin to monitor reactions. Another option is a blood test to measure IgE antibodies, which indicate allergic sensitivity. These methods are precise and can pinpoint specific allergens, though they require medical supervision and may involve costs or discomfort.

Prevention is key while testing. Avoid prolonged exposure to scented candles, especially if you’re already prone to allergies or asthma. Opt for unscented, natural wax candles (like soy or beeswax) during this period. Keep a symptom journal to track reactions and patterns, noting the type of candle, burn time, and environmental factors. This data can help you and your healthcare provider identify triggers more effectively. Remember, self-testing has limits—always seek professional advice for a definitive diagnosis.

Scented candles, while cozy and inviting, can trigger allergies in sensitive individuals. Fragrances, dyes, and even the wax itself may release irritants when burned. To minimize risks, start by choosing candles made from natural waxes like soy or beeswax, which produce fewer emissions compared to paraffin. Opt for fragrance-free or essential oil-based scents, avoiding synthetic perfumes that often contain phthalates—chemicals linked to allergic reactions.

Ventilation is key. Always burn candles in well-ventilated areas to disperse airborne particles. Use an exhaust fan or open a window, especially in smaller rooms. Limit burn time to 1–2 hours per session, as prolonged exposure increases the likelihood of irritation. For those with severe allergies, consider alternatives like fragrance-free LED candles or diffusers with hypoallergenic essential oils.

Placement matters. Keep candles away from drafts to prevent uneven burning, which can release more smoke and particles. Trim wicks to ¼ inch before each use to reduce soot. Clean candle jars regularly to remove buildup, as dust and debris can exacerbate allergies when heated. For households with children or pets, ensure candles are placed out of reach to avoid accidental exposure.

Monitor symptoms closely. If you experience sneezing, headaches, or respiratory discomfort while burning candles, discontinue use immediately. Consult an allergist to identify specific triggers, as reactions can vary widely. While scented candles can enhance ambiance, prioritizing health through mindful selection and usage ensures a safer, more enjoyable experience.
